INTRODUCTION

The people at Cambridge SoundWorks hope you enjoy
your new high-performance SoundWorks Radio CD 745.
Your new radio has great FM stereo sound and plays
useful AM band stations. It stores 16 FM station presets
along with 8 AM station presets. An integral, slot-load disc
player plays audio CDs and MP3/WMA files on CD-ROM.
The large 32-character display and full-function remote
makes radio operation easy from across the room.
The SoundWorks Radio CD 745 displays three types of
supplementary text:
Radio Data Service (RDS) FM station text
CD-text
"ID3" text stored in most MP3 and WMA files.
An automatic dimmer function reduces display brightness
in dark rooms while maintaining good legibility in bright
light. An internal long-life power cell maintains the current
time accurately for many years. By inserting a 9V battery
(not supplied), a user ensures that an activated wakeup
function will work even during a power outage.
A front input jack allows easy connection of audio program
sources (like portable digital music and cassette players).
A convenient JOG button lets you select from a variety of
secondary adjustments (Bass and Treble, Snooze time
and Text display modes, among others).
